Propel Zero + Bullet

My surgery is 4 weeks away and I am trying to find Protein that I like. Propel Zero Sport (1 liter bottle at Walmart) with 1 whey protein bullet (42 gram ones at Walmart) is so good! I used the grape protein in grape Propel and fruit punch bullet in the berry propel. I have not tried any Isopure or the other clear Proteins so I don't have anything to compare. Hope this helps!!

I've read that the bullets often have an unusable form of Protein so you many want to investigate that. I like the Isopure Zero Carb but it's a bit pricey. I've found a couple of others at the Vitamin Shoppe that I like - Protein Blitz and Cytosport Whey Isolate Protein RTD. You might try those too.

Good luck!

I was also told the bullets would not work for us. Anything with collagen or gelatin wasn't good protein. Even though it says whey protein on it it's still no good.
